drm/panthor: return error on truncated firmware

panthor_fw_load() detects truncated firmware images, but jumps to the
common cleanup path without setting ret. If no previous error was recorded,
the function can return 0 and treat the invalid firmware as successfully
loaded.

Set ret to -EINVAL before leaving the truncated-image path.
